Binlog update_rows

WebNov 1, 2024 · ROW causes logging to be row based. This is the default. MIXED causes logging to use mixed format. You can choose one by setting the binlog_format configuration option. What you are seeing in your log is the row format. It lists the row to update (with all its values). This is not supposed to be your original query, it just looks similar. WebApr 14, 2024 · WRITE_ROW_EVENT:插入操作。 DELETE_ROW_EVENT:删除操作。 UPDATE_ROW_EVENT:更新操作。记载的是一条记录的完整的变化情况,即从前量 …

MySQL :: MySQL 5.7 Reference Manual :: 13.7.6.1 BINLOG Statement

WebYou can tell mysqlbinlog to suppress the BINLOG statements for row events by using the --base64-output=DECODE-ROWS option. This is similar to --base64-output=NEVER but does not exit with an error if a row event is found. The combination of --base64-output=DECODE-ROWS and --verbose provides a convenient way to see row events … WebApr 12, 2024 · 根据 Binlog 事件类型处理对应事件,将 INSERT/UPDATE/DELETE 等 DML 事件转换成标准 SQL 语句;对于 DDL 事件则直接输出。 ... binlog_row_image = full(建议开启),如果为 minimal 模式,Binlog2sync 也能正常工作,binlog2sync 解析到具体表时,如果没有缓存该表结构,则通过 ... iowa dot license plate custom https://compassllcfl.com

Troubleshooting MySQL Replication: Part One Severalnines

WebMay 6, 2024 · The binlog may grow faster, or maybe slower; it really depends on the types of queries that are replicated. For example, a million-row UPDATE (a naughty thing to … WebMar 28, 2024 · As we can see, the oldest binary log entry that’s available is: 5d1e2227-07c6-11e7-8123-080027495a77:1106669 We need also to check what’s the last GTID covered in the backup: root@slave1:~# cat /var/lib/mysql/xtrabackup_binlog_info binlog.000017 194 5d1e2227-07c6-11e7-8123-080027495a77:1-1106666 WebOct 12, 2024 · Search for the parameter binlog_format -> Select it -> Edit Parameters -> Select Row. After you do this, you will need to restart your instance to apply this new parameter value. After your database is back … opal charm bracelet silver

MySQL :: MySQL 8.0 Reference Manual :: 13.7.8.1 BINLOG Statement

Category:SpringBoot整合Canal+RabbitMQ监听数据变更 - CSDN博客

Tags:Binlog update_rows

Binlog update_rows

Read MySQL Binlogs better with rows query log events

Web4.6.9.2 mysqlbinlog Row Event Display. The following examples illustrate how mysqlbinlog displays row events that specify data modifications. These correspond to events with the … WebApr 11, 2024 · Row:基于行格式 Row模式下,主库会将每次DML操作引发的数据具体行变化记录在Binlog中并复制到从库上,从库根据行的变更记录来对应地修改数据,但DDL类型的操作依然是以Statement的格式记录。

Binlog update_rows

Did you know?

WebMay 7, 2011 · Mysql row-based binary logging seems to have a different behaviour when grouping rows changes in some versions of mysql. Let's assume the following statement update three rows: UPDATE table_name SET a=1 WHERE id IN (1, 2, 3); In mysql 5.7.21: The binary log receive only one log containing the 3 rows changes. (Which is my desired … Web13.7.6.1 BINLOG Statement. BINLOG is an internal-use statement. It is generated by the mysqlbinlog program as the printable representation of certain events in binary log files. …

Web4.6.9.2 mysqlbinlog Row Event Display. The following examples illustrate how mysqlbinlog displays row events that specify data modifications. These correspond to events with the … WebApr 13, 2024 · 我想要在SpringBoot中采用一种与业务代码解耦合的方式,来实现数据的变更记录,记录的内容是新数据,如果是更新操作还得有旧数据内容。. 经过调研发现,使用Canal来监听MySQL的binlog变化可以实现这个需求,可是在监听到变化后需要马上保存变更记录,除非再做 ...

WebMay 7, 2024 · The binlog may grow faster, or maybe slower; it really depends on the types of queries that are replicated. For example, a million-row UPDATE (a naughty thing to do) will be one statement (the UPDATE) in STATEMENT mode and will be a million row-changes in ROW mode. In this example, ROW will fill up more disk; the admin task will … WebNov 15, 2024 · Support all mysql binlog event. Get binlog event through network connections. Multi threads binlog dumper. Flash back base on row format binary log. more.

WebJul 9, 2024 · With the native mysqlbinlog tool, we can convert the binary logs from binary to text format. We can also generate the exact SQL statements using the mysqlbinlog utility. It depends on the …

WebJun 7, 2024 · To restore data from binlog files, you need to perform a full backup correctly. mysqldump -u root -ppassword --flush-logs --delete-master-logs --all-databases > full-backup.sql. There are two important parameters in the command: --flush-logs - this parameter starts writing to a new binlog file. --delete-master-logs - removes old binlog … opal charleston scWebJun 19, 2024 · The MySQL BinLog (Binary Logs) is responsible for handling these updates and hence provide a description of such events to indicate the changes made to the database being used. These can be … opal chemistryWeb而且上面还有很多 Update_rows 的操作。 猜测:会不会是主库执行了一个大事务,造成该事务生成的一条 binlog 日志太大了,从库生成的对应的一条 relay log 日志也很大, SQL 线程去解析这条 relay log 日志解析报错。 3.5.2 验证 opal cherrywood groveWebDescription We add new event types to support compress the binlog as follow: QUERY_COMPRESSED_EVENT, WRITE_ROWS_COMPRESSED_EVENT_V1, UPDATE_ROWS_COMPRESSED_EVENT_V1, DELETE_POWS_COMPRESSED_EVENT_V1, … opal checkpoints panelsWebFeb 22, 2012 · Lets say you fired up an UPDATE Statement: UPDATE tb_Employee_Stats SET lazy = 1 WHERE ep_id = 1234 Lets say if the Column's Value is already 1; then no update process occurs thus mysql_affected_rows() will return 0; else if Column lazy had some other value rather than 1, then 1 is returned. There is no other possibilities except … iowa dot marshalltownWebConclusion – MySQL Binlog. MySQL Binlog is a binary log, which consists of all the modifications that happened in the database. All the details are written in the server in … iowa dot knowledge examopal chemicals perth